Directions:
Mix together eggs, four, milk, sugar, vanilla and baking powder. Add nuts and dates, and beat well. Beat egg whites until very stiff. Fold into mixture.

Place in greased and floured muffin tin, and cook at 350 degrees for 20 minutes.

After they cool, top with whipped cream and a candied cherry.
